An object is placed at the centre of curvature (2f) of a concave mirror. The image formed is:

Answer: at 2f, real, inverted, and same size.

  • A at the focus
  • B at 2f, real, inverted, and same size
  • C at infinity
  • D virtual and erect

Correct answer: B. at 2f, real, inverted, and same size

Explanation: For an object at 2f of a concave mirror the image is at 2f, real, inverted, and of the same size.
